## Releases

Addrly, our address autocomplete widget, ships on a two-week cadence. Support should know: each release is tagged, built by the Corvette pipeline, and published to the partner CDN. If a customer reports stale suggestions, first check which widget version they embed — the version string appears in the network panel. Hotfixes skip the cadence but follow the same signing flow. Every published bundle must be verified against our release key, shown below for reference.

deploy key for kajof-fajop: bky6_gDHw9Q

## Break-Glass Access — TimeLoom Solver

Welcome, plugin folks! Normally you only hit the TimeLoom sandbox API, and that's plenty for building timetable plugins for the Oakmere district pilot. But if your plugin corrupts a solver run mid-term (it happens — ask Dario), you may need break-glass access to roll back the constraint store. Use it sparingly; every use pings the Wrenfield ops channel and gets reviewed. The emergency vault unlocks the rollback tooling, and its recovery passphrase is written just below this line.

unlock words, yawig-kagef: gordor-holvan-ulaael-pramir-ulaiel-tamdor

14:02 — Quillsheet export workers on the Marrowvale cluster hit 92% heap. 14:07 — OOM kills began; exports over 200k rows failing. 14:11 — On-call confirmed the streaming writer was buffering whole sheets after the Tuesday deploy. 14:19 — Rolled back export service to previous image; memory flat within four minutes. 14:25 — Backlog drained. Root cause traced to a serializer flag flipped in the offending build, recorded below for reference.

pipeline stamp: htk31_f769b577b3028a4e9958e5bb8d1259a

## Deployment

The Routewise driver-assignment heuristic ships as a standalone service that plugin authors target over the scoring API. Deploy it behind your own gateway; it holds no state beyond an in-memory candidate cache. Plugins are loaded at startup from the configured directory and cannot be swapped live. Scoring weights and cache behavior are controlled entirely through the settings below, which the service reads once at boot.

deployment values, yadug-bawif:
[framir]
team = pelox
access_code = ac_a38ab2
owner = tamion.julael
host = framir.tolvaqlabs.test
port = 11211
peer = tammir.zemvargrid.local
salt = 2215ef03
pin = 1541